Transaction 3d84c15a96991c0d19c679867661cdfb96bb8b29109cd8608dee672a75bf29b2
1 Input
1 Output
-
3d84c15a96991c0d19c679867661cdfb96bb8b29109cd8608dee672a75bf29b2:0
- value
- 284176
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 45d3e6470435c112dde40d6f28ae90f638150e50 OP_EQUAL
- address
- 384EPpLHE56yDbFH8gexQkZQPrDsSdE7EW